Columbus School is a vibrant and diverse learning community, serving approximately 650 students in grades PreK–4. Aligned with the Carteret Public School District’s mission—drawing on our cultural richness, Carteret Public Schools inspires and empowers students to be innovative, respectful, and confident leaders who will RISE to shape the world—we are committed to fostering a collaborative environment that supports the academic, social, and emotional growth of every child.
At Columbus School, we take pride in offering a rigorous, high-quality, and personalized education. Our PreK students learn through the Tools of the Mind curriculum, while students in Grades K–4 engage in Reader’s and Writer’s Workshop through the Being a Reader and Being a Writer programs, as well as a Math Workshop model. A key component of both our literacy and math instruction is small group instruction, which allows teachers to meet students at their individual levels, provide targeted support, and promote academic growth for all learners. This approach ensures that instruction is data-driven, differentiated, and responsive to student needs.
Our S.P.A.R.K. enrichment program offers selected students the opportunity to explore advanced content through engaging units of study that integrate humanities, STEM, and independent inquiry. Students also utilize Google Classroom, create multimedia projects, and access a variety of online platforms that extend and enrich the curriculum.
Additionally, we have fully implemented a robust Response to Intervention (RTI) model in Grades K–3, providing targeted support through evidence-based programs such as Orton-Gillingham and SIPPS, further supporting early literacy development and foundational skills.
